Been here for the first time last weekend and it's been a good experience. Excellent ambience for fine-dining. It's a South East Asian fusion restaurant with some amazing varieties of food which is not that common in all newzealand restaurants. One thing I have to mention mainly is the friendly staffs, excellent service and really welcoming, eventhough the restaurant is pretty busy, they always ensure the customers get the help they need (for eg: topping up water, ordering desserts). Talking about the dishes we had, we had a black pepper chicken dish, a duck curry (red curry) with pineapple and potatoes, a goat curry.( green curry).The gravy tasted similar but the flavour of the meat wqs really highlighting in both the curries makes the dish unique in it's own way. Out of all the dishes, personally I liked the goat better because of it's rich flavour.. the other dishes were good too, don't get me wrong there. Talking about the quantity, both the goat and duck curries had good portion whereas the black pepper chicken was a bit not satisfying for the price we paid. Desserts are a must try especially the chocolate & hazelnut mousse cake. What I didn't like about the restaurant is obviously the price, it's on the expensive side. Other than that nothing much to complain. Enjoyed all the food we ordered. Definitely will visit again.

The menu offers a wide variety of delicious Asian Infusion style food. mouth watering starters and main courses that will appeal to youngsters and adults alike. For starters we had Red Curry Spicy Salmon on Crispy Wonton, amazing, with a bit of spice! And the Sticky Hot Wings, Gochujang, Chipotle, The sauce was amazing, almost filled me up. For mains my wife had our favourite. Crispy-Skinned Market Fish, Sweet & Sticky Pork, Pear, Radish, Peanuts, Herbs, The flavours all go well together, Very tasty. And I had to try a curry dish this time. Went with Madurese Goat Curry, Lime, Coconut. Meat was soft, melts in your mouth, Amazing flavours. Highly Recommend!! Amazing dessert!! We had Apple & Almond Tart, Miso-Butterscotch Sauce, Salted Caramel Ice Cream, one of a kind, And our favourite Coconut Sago, Vanilla Ice Cream, Puffed Black Rice. I highly recommend this restaurant. The food is delicious and the atmosphere is brilliant. We love this place and will continue to visit!!

My friends and I had a fantastic dinner at Mekong Baby! The restaurant had a great atmosphere and the food was really tasty. We tried several dishes, including the Madras Spicy chicken curry, which had a wonderful flavor but was very spicy and didn't have as much chicken as we expected. The black pepper chicken was amazing, but it had chicken skin on it which wasn't pleasant while eating. Despite that, the flavor was incredible and I would definitely order it again. Our favorite dish was probably the pad See Ew - it had a great portion size and tasted delicious! We also ordered desserts, and the apple and almond tart was my personal favorite. The coconut sago was beautiful and the chocolate and hazelnut mousse cake was very rich - perfect for sharing between two people. Overall, we had a great time at Mekong Baby and would definitely recommend it to anyone looking for tasty food and a nice ambiance.
